張峰
(中煤航測(cè)遙感局遙感應(yīng)用研究院,西安 710054)
基于Skyline的礦山三維電子沙盤(pán)研究
張峰
(中煤航測(cè)遙感局遙感應(yīng)用研究院,西安 710054)
利用遙感技術(shù)、地理信息系統(tǒng)和虛擬現(xiàn)實(shí)技術(shù),建立了虛擬三維電子沙盤(pán)場(chǎng)景。將礦山監(jiān)測(cè)開(kāi)發(fā)要素、礦山環(huán)境要素信息及地形地貌、河流山脈等地物信息直觀地呈現(xiàn)在人們面前。該技術(shù)可以全面實(shí)現(xiàn)礦山地理信息、礦山要素信息的三維可視化,為決策管理提供模擬、仿真和過(guò)程分析的信息平臺(tái)和技術(shù)支撐。
礦山;電子沙盤(pán);監(jiān)測(cè)
三維電子沙盤(pán)又稱(chēng)三維地理信息系統(tǒng),是遙感、地理信息系統(tǒng)和三維仿真等高新技術(shù)的結(jié)合。本研究將美國(guó)Skyline軟件的Terra Suite系列產(chǎn)品作為系統(tǒng)的三維城市軟件平臺(tái),在二次開(kāi)發(fā)的基礎(chǔ)上,對(duì)各類(lèi)礦山監(jiān)測(cè)成果數(shù)據(jù)進(jìn)行加載。礦山監(jiān)測(cè)的目標(biāo)是利用遙感技術(shù)對(duì)礦產(chǎn)資源開(kāi)發(fā)利用狀況與礦山環(huán)境方面進(jìn)行調(diào)查監(jiān)測(cè),將三維地理信息系統(tǒng)技術(shù)應(yīng)用于礦山監(jiān)測(cè)之中,可以模擬出監(jiān)測(cè)礦山的地形地貌,形成直觀的認(rèn)識(shí)。該技術(shù)的應(yīng)用在判斷礦山開(kāi)發(fā)狀況和礦山環(huán)境專(zhuān)題信息時(shí)可以提高工作的效率和精度,對(duì)礦山地質(zhì)災(zāi)害判斷及分析也具有很大的幫助。
本次電子沙盤(pán)以遙感圖像處理技術(shù)及GIS技術(shù)為支撐,借助現(xiàn)有GIS、RS圖像處理軟件實(shí)現(xiàn)DEM(數(shù)字高程模型)數(shù)據(jù)、遙感影像柵格數(shù)據(jù)、各類(lèi)專(zhuān)題、地理矢量信息數(shù)據(jù)、標(biāo)注信息數(shù)據(jù)的疊加,最后通過(guò)編程完成各功能模塊的開(kāi)發(fā),實(shí)現(xiàn)各數(shù)據(jù)層的集成及三維飛行顯示等功能。技術(shù)路線如圖1所示。
圖1 電子沙盤(pán)技術(shù)路線Fig.1 Flow chart of the electronic sand table
2.1 DEM數(shù)據(jù)及衛(wèi)星影像處理
DEM是地形表面形態(tài)屬性信息的數(shù)字表達(dá),是帶有空間位置特征和地形屬性特征的數(shù)字描述。DEM數(shù)據(jù)生成包括高程數(shù)據(jù)數(shù)字化、TIN數(shù)據(jù)生成、Grid數(shù)據(jù)生成、Grid轉(zhuǎn)換img這幾個(gè)部分。選用ArcView矢量軟件制作DEM,對(duì)地形圖等高線及高程點(diǎn)進(jìn)行數(shù)字化,在此過(guò)程中將高程信息賦予屬性字段;隨后將數(shù)字化好的等高線、高程點(diǎn)矢量數(shù)據(jù)作為數(shù)據(jù)源,對(duì)這些矢量數(shù)據(jù)進(jìn)行查錯(cuò)檢查,創(chuàng)建TIN數(shù)據(jù);在ArcView的3D分析模塊中將數(shù)字化好的等高線和高程點(diǎn)轉(zhuǎn)換為T(mén)IN數(shù)據(jù),高程源設(shè)置為高程值字段,利用3D分析功能將TIN轉(zhuǎn)換為柵格的Grid數(shù)據(jù);最終將此數(shù)據(jù)格式轉(zhuǎn)換為img格式的數(shù)據(jù),生成符合工作區(qū)范圍的DEM數(shù)據(jù)。
圖像處理與制作包括圖像融合、幾何糾正、數(shù)字鑲嵌、波段合成、反差調(diào)整等步驟。最終圖像要求接近真彩色,能真實(shí)表現(xiàn)地物特征(圖2)。
圖2 工作區(qū)局部遙感影像Fig.2 Remote sensing image of the local workspace
2.2 專(zhuān)題和地理數(shù)據(jù)處理
以正射影像圖為基礎(chǔ),按照遙感圖像紋理特征,解譯編制區(qū)內(nèi)矢量圖斑要素,轉(zhuǎn)存為ArcView的.shp格式的矢量文件,并對(duì)各類(lèi)型圖斑要素賦予屬性值,以完成專(zhuān)題矢量數(shù)據(jù)提取。地理要素是以地形圖為基礎(chǔ)資料,提取地域、山川、河流名等標(biāo)注信息,并將其轉(zhuǎn)換為.shp格式點(diǎn)文件,在屬性字段中賦予其名稱(chēng)屬性要素;提取交通、河流等線狀地理要素信息,將其轉(zhuǎn)換為.shp格式線文件,以備錄入系統(tǒng)。
2.3 三維電子沙盤(pán)數(shù)據(jù)集成
數(shù)據(jù)集成及三維立體可視化顯示的工作就是電子沙盤(pán)的實(shí)現(xiàn)過(guò)程。利用Skyline軟件平臺(tái),將處理完成的遙感影像和DEM相疊加,生成工作區(qū)三維地理模型,完成電子沙盤(pán)基本場(chǎng)景的制作。首先,將遙感影像進(jìn)行校正,使其與DEM高程模型采用相同的坐標(biāo)投影方式,以完成三維地理模型的匹配;其次,將處理的地理及專(zhuān)題矢量要素信息加載場(chǎng)景之中,在場(chǎng)景中矢量線畫(huà)要緊貼地形表面,地理及專(zhuān)題點(diǎn)注記則根據(jù)屬性字段以billbord形式展現(xiàn)(當(dāng)場(chǎng)景的觀察位置變化時(shí),文字注記的位置也會(huì)隨著視點(diǎn)的變化而相應(yīng)的改變)。但在場(chǎng)景制作過(guò)程中發(fā)現(xiàn)這種標(biāo)注方法只適合于注記相對(duì)較少的區(qū)域,若某一區(qū)域注記密集,則這種方法會(huì)使得場(chǎng)景顯得雜亂無(wú)序,考慮到這種情況,對(duì)場(chǎng)景中的注記信息進(jìn)行了修改,使注記只在距離視點(diǎn)某一固定區(qū)域內(nèi)進(jìn)行顯示,而在范圍之外的則使其隱藏,這要就使得整個(gè)場(chǎng)景顯得干凈有序,場(chǎng)景最終生成的效果如圖3所示。
圖3 電子沙盤(pán)場(chǎng)景Fig.3 The electronic sand table scene
在系統(tǒng)設(shè)計(jì)與開(kāi)發(fā)實(shí)現(xiàn)過(guò)程中,充分發(fā)揮了Windows在人機(jī)交互界面、圖形程序界面等方面的優(yōu)勢(shì)。電子沙盤(pán)系統(tǒng)的功能模塊是利用Visual Basic 6.0開(kāi)發(fā)的,采用美國(guó) Skyline軟件的 Terra Suite系列軟件產(chǎn)品作為系統(tǒng)的三維城市軟件平臺(tái),利用TerraGate對(duì)三維空間數(shù)據(jù)進(jìn)行發(fā)布,利用API接口開(kāi)發(fā)完成三維系統(tǒng)對(duì)基礎(chǔ)地理信息數(shù)據(jù)庫(kù)的SDE空間數(shù)據(jù)庫(kù)引擎的空間數(shù)據(jù)庫(kù)的加載,同時(shí)在二次開(kāi)發(fā)的基礎(chǔ)上完成對(duì)專(zhuān)題應(yīng)用數(shù)據(jù)庫(kù)中的各類(lèi)所需要檔案數(shù)據(jù)和其他成果數(shù)據(jù)的加載。
該電子沙盤(pán)與礦山監(jiān)測(cè)相結(jié)合,在三維系統(tǒng)中針對(duì)各類(lèi)要素進(jìn)行編輯,不僅保留了地理信息系統(tǒng)的基本分析功能(測(cè)量功能、生成等高線、生成地形剖面、視域分析、威脅區(qū)分析等)、三維虛擬技術(shù)的特有功能(在場(chǎng)景中根據(jù)需求在場(chǎng)景中自由觀察,這種漫游方式可以實(shí)現(xiàn)場(chǎng)景的平移、角度旋轉(zhuǎn)、遠(yuǎn)近縮放、定點(diǎn)縮放等功能,另外還可以實(shí)現(xiàn)沿給定路線進(jìn)行自動(dòng)漫游飛行并輸出漫游過(guò)程的視頻文件,以供分析需求),更針對(duì)礦山監(jiān)測(cè)的特點(diǎn)設(shè)計(jì)了其特殊的分析、查詢、編輯功能,見(jiàn)圖4。
圖4 礦山電子沙盤(pán)界面Fig.4 Them ine electronic sand table interface
根據(jù)礦山監(jiān)測(cè)特點(diǎn),該電子沙盤(pán)的主要特點(diǎn)有:
(1)通過(guò)DEM及影像的疊加,直觀反映礦山地形地貌景觀特點(diǎn),對(duì)工作區(qū)形成直觀感性的認(rèn)識(shí)。
(2)集成海量DEM及遙感影像數(shù)據(jù),將多種類(lèi)型、多種分辨率的海量數(shù)據(jù)一體化三維表現(xiàn),進(jìn)行海量數(shù)據(jù)大范圍實(shí)時(shí)漫游,保證遙感影像數(shù)據(jù)精度的同時(shí)又可以滿足三維瀏覽速度。
(3)在對(duì)監(jiān)測(cè)區(qū)進(jìn)行解譯的過(guò)程中,結(jié)合電子沙盤(pán)提供的地形地貌信息,可以更為準(zhǔn)確地判斷圖斑的邊界及屬性;將三維地形信息應(yīng)用于地質(zhì)災(zāi)害分析時(shí)更有利于對(duì)威脅對(duì)象、匯水情況等作出正確的判斷。
(4)該礦山電子沙盤(pán)可將不同工作區(qū)、不同時(shí)期的監(jiān)測(cè)結(jié)果集成一體,分類(lèi)存放,其系統(tǒng)可以包含多個(gè)監(jiān)測(cè)區(qū)的成果,每個(gè)監(jiān)測(cè)區(qū)則包含該礦山監(jiān)測(cè)的所有矢量數(shù)據(jù)。
(5)利用數(shù)據(jù)庫(kù)技術(shù)將礦山監(jiān)測(cè)矢量數(shù)據(jù)屬性作為沙盤(pán)數(shù)據(jù)庫(kù)文件,在瀏覽三維場(chǎng)景的同時(shí)對(duì)監(jiān)測(cè)數(shù)據(jù)屬性進(jìn)行瀏覽,直觀地反映各類(lèi)數(shù)據(jù)的監(jiān)測(cè)成果情況。
(6)通過(guò)數(shù)據(jù)庫(kù)的鏈接可實(shí)現(xiàn)對(duì)場(chǎng)景中照片、視頻等野外實(shí)地調(diào)查資料的瀏覽,并根據(jù)驗(yàn)證點(diǎn)設(shè)置飛行線路,實(shí)現(xiàn)沿野外的行車(chē)路線進(jìn)行漫游瀏覽,校對(duì)監(jiān)測(cè)圖斑的準(zhǔn)確性。
(7)將監(jiān)測(cè)區(qū)礦產(chǎn)資源開(kāi)發(fā)狀況和礦山環(huán)境簡(jiǎn)報(bào)集成于電子沙盤(pán)之中,在瀏覽礦區(qū)的過(guò)程中同時(shí)實(shí)現(xiàn)簡(jiǎn)報(bào)的核對(duì)。
(8)通過(guò)對(duì)監(jiān)測(cè)區(qū)非法開(kāi)采情況設(shè)置地標(biāo),能快速定位到該點(diǎn)位,實(shí)現(xiàn)對(duì)該處地形地貌及非法開(kāi)采狀況的瀏覽,并同時(shí)通過(guò)屬性查詢了解該處非法開(kāi)采的相關(guān)監(jiān)測(cè)資料情況。
(9)針對(duì)敏感地區(qū),通過(guò)設(shè)置觀察點(diǎn)視角輸出該處三維圖件,可設(shè)置輸出圖片的尺寸大小等參數(shù)。
該系統(tǒng)目前已將陜西子長(zhǎng)、鳳縣、洛南、寧夏石炭井礦區(qū)數(shù)據(jù)錄入完畢,遙感影像數(shù)據(jù)分別采用IKONOS和SPOT 5作為數(shù)據(jù)源,DEM數(shù)據(jù)針對(duì)不同精度的影像采用5 m和10 m等高距數(shù)據(jù),大小共計(jì)14 G,各類(lèi)礦山監(jiān)測(cè)圖斑共計(jì)2 148個(gè),野外驗(yàn)證照片237張,視頻6'23″,目前場(chǎng)景三維瀏覽速度流暢,未出現(xiàn)斷幀現(xiàn)象。該技術(shù)模擬的虛擬場(chǎng)景客觀的反映了實(shí)地的地形地貌情況,利用該系統(tǒng)的三維地形顯示與數(shù)據(jù)庫(kù)技術(shù),更有利于對(duì)礦山開(kāi)發(fā)及礦山地質(zhì)災(zāi)害各類(lèi)矢量要素分布情況的判斷和確定,提高解譯的精度與效率。
(1)三維地理信息系統(tǒng)是GIS發(fā)展趨勢(shì)之一。與傳統(tǒng)的圖像處理軟件制作的三維場(chǎng)景相比較,基于Skyline的礦山三維電子沙盤(pán)系統(tǒng)更具互動(dòng)性,可以準(zhǔn)確的反映礦山地形信息,通過(guò)遙感影像的疊加詳細(xì)地表述地表信息狀況,模擬實(shí)地景觀特點(diǎn),如身臨其境,通過(guò)三維技術(shù)實(shí)現(xiàn)方便快捷的對(duì)場(chǎng)景實(shí)時(shí)漫游飛行,另外應(yīng)用數(shù)據(jù)庫(kù)技術(shù)實(shí)現(xiàn)對(duì)礦山成果的查詢與分析。
(2)目前該技術(shù)仍需要改進(jìn)的地方在于該系統(tǒng)只能裝載于單一計(jì)算機(jī)上,下步工作擬采用瀏覽器/服務(wù)器(B/S)的架構(gòu),針對(duì)行業(yè)及公眾用戶,提供基于Web的多源、多比例尺海量空間數(shù)據(jù)管理、共享及發(fā)布、查詢、統(tǒng)計(jì)分析等功能。另外還缺少礦山監(jiān)測(cè)綜合分析能力,需要進(jìn)一步加強(qiáng)改善。
[1]朱國(guó)敏,馬照亭,孫隆祥,等.城市三維地理信息系統(tǒng)中海量數(shù)據(jù)的數(shù)據(jù)庫(kù)組織與管理[J].測(cè)繪科學(xué),2008(1):238-240,254.
[2]符海芳,朱建軍,崔偉宏.3DGIS數(shù)據(jù)模型的研究[J].地球信息科學(xué),2002(2):45-49.
[3]袁存忠.基于Skyline的福建省三維地理信息公共平臺(tái)的研建[J].測(cè)繪通報(bào),2009(2):54 -56,69.
[4]ESRI.Using ArcGIS 3D Analyst[M].Redlands,California:Environmental Systems Research Institute,Inc,2000 -2002.
[5]洪安龍,許大璐,梁劍芳.基于Skyline的三維地理信息系統(tǒng)應(yīng)用的實(shí)踐[J].浙江國(guó)土資源,2009(3):49-50.
[6]王志杰,汪云甲,伏永明.基于虛擬現(xiàn)實(shí)技術(shù)的礦山三維建模、顯示及漫游系統(tǒng)[J].測(cè)繪工程,2006(1):44-47.
[7]潘結(jié)南,孟召平,甘 莉.礦山三維地質(zhì)建模與可視化研究[J].煤田地質(zhì)與勘探,2005(1):16-18.
[9]呂國(guó)梁,孫 敏,周曉光.基于視點(diǎn)的3維模型動(dòng)態(tài)注記方法[J].地理信息世界,2008(2):53-57.
(責(zé)任編輯:李 瑜)
Research on the Electronic Sand Table for the Mine Based on the Platform of Skyline
ZHANG Feng
(Remote Sensing Application Institute of ARSC,Xi'an 710054 China)
With the remote sensing technology,geographic information systems and virtual reality technology,the authors established a virtual three-dimensional electronic sand scene.This design presents the features of mine exploitation and environment,topography,rivers,mountains and other surface information in the audio - visual way.the Electronic Sand Table can fully realize visualization of mine elements of information,which is likely to provide a platform and technical support for decision-maker.
Mine;Electronic sand table;Monitoring
張 峰(1964-),男,高級(jí)工程師,主要從事遙感技術(shù)開(kāi)發(fā)工作。
TP 75
A
1001-070X(2010)04-0122-04
2010-03-11;
2010-04-28
陜西渭北煤田及周邊能源成礦帶與礦集區(qū)礦山開(kāi)發(fā)遙感調(diào)查與監(jiān)測(cè)項(xiàng)目(編號(hào):1212010911092)。